[LINUX] VirtualBox에서 디스크 크기 변경하기(동적할당, 고정할당)

동적할당의 경우

VBoxManage명령의 modifyhd 옵션을 통해 디스크 정보에 대해 변경이 가능합니다. –resize를 주어 사이즈를 변경하면 되죠. 단위는 MB 단위이니 잘 확인하시고 하시길

#> VBoxManage modifyhd blackarch_.vdi –resize 20000 0%…10%…20%…30%…40%…50%…60%…70%…80%…90%…100%

고정할당의 경우

고정할당의 경우 VBoxManage 명령이나 VirtualBox에서 직접 변경이 불가능합니다.

고정할당에서 동적할당으로 바로 변경은 불가능합니다. 약간 편법을 통해 해결이 가능한데요. 먼저 파일 > 가상미디어 관리자 로 들어가 기존 고정할당된 vdi 파일을 복사해줍니다.

복사한 경로로 가서 방금 복사한 vdi 파일의 사이즈를 변경해줍니다.

#> ll 합계 14821508 drwxrwxr-x 3 hahwul hahwul 4096 9월 27 11:01 ./ drwxrwxr-x 4 hahwul hahwul 4096 9월 26 10:25 ../ drwx—— 2 hahwul hahwul 4096 9월 27 10:58 Logs/ -rw——- 1 hahwul hahwul 8605 9월 27 11:01 blackarch.vbox -rw——- 1 hahwul hahwul 8605 9월 27 10:59 blackarch.vbox-prev -rw——- 1 hahwul hahwul 10739515392 9월 27 10:59 blackarch.vdi -rw——- 1 hahwul hahwul 4441767936 9월 27 11:01 blackarch_.vdi

#> VBoxManage modifyhd blackarch_.vdi –resize 20000 0%…10%…20%…30%…40%…50%…60%…70%…80%…90%…100%

그다음 VirtualBox 의 각 가상머신의 설정을 통해 다시 로드해주시면..

복사한 파일과 원본이 존재하게 됩니다. 사용하실 것(복사한 파일)만 연결해주시면 되고, 가상 미디어 관리자로 들어가서 고정으로 다시 변경해주시면 전체적으로 고정 디스크에 대해 변경한 것과 동일한 상황이 됩니다.